[llvm-commits] [poolalloc] r138041 - /poolalloc/trunk/lib/DSA/StdLibPass.cpp

John Criswell criswell at uiuc.edu
Fri Aug 19 09:39:19 PDT 2011


Author: criswell
Date: Fri Aug 19 11:39:19 2011
New Revision: 138041

URL: http://llvm.org/viewvc/llvm-project?rev=138041&view=rev
Log:
Do not treat fastlscheck() like exactcheck2(); it does not have a pointer
return value.  Instead, treat it like poolcheck().

Modified:
    poolalloc/trunk/lib/DSA/StdLibPass.cpp

Modified: poolalloc/trunk/lib/DSA/StdLibPass.cpp
URL: http://llvm.org/viewvc/llvm-project/poolalloc/trunk/lib/DSA/StdLibPass.cpp?rev=138041&r1=138040&r2=138041&view=diff
==============================================================================
--- poolalloc/trunk/lib/DSA/StdLibPass.cpp (original)
+++ poolalloc/trunk/lib/DSA/StdLibPass.cpp Fri Aug 19 11:39:19 2011
@@ -256,6 +256,7 @@
   // SAFECode Intrinsics
   {"poolcheck",        {NRET_NARGS, NRET_NARGS, NRET_NARGS, NRET_NARGS, false}},
   {"poolcheckui",      {NRET_NARGS, NRET_NARGS, NRET_NARGS, NRET_NARGS, false}},
+  {"fastlscheck",      {NRET_NARGS, NRET_NARGS, NRET_NARGS, NRET_NARGS, false}},
   {"poolcheckalign",   {NRET_NARGS, NRET_NARGS, NRET_NARGS, NRET_NARGS, false}},
   {"poolcheckalignui", {NRET_NARGS, NRET_NARGS, NRET_NARGS, NRET_NARGS, false}},
 
@@ -595,7 +596,6 @@
     processRuntimeCheck (M, "boundscheck", 2);
     processRuntimeCheck (M, "boundscheckui", 2);
     processRuntimeCheck (M, "exactcheck2", 1);
-    processRuntimeCheck (M, "fastlscheck", 1);
     processRuntimeCheck (M, "pchk_getActualValue", 1);
   }
 





More information about the llvm-commits mailing list